Subject: EventForge schema registry v4 — action needed

Plugin authors: registry v4 goes live Monday. Breaking change: nested payload versions are now enforced, not advisory. Pin your schemas before the cutover or publishes will be rejected. Migration notes are on the Forgeline wiki. Validate your plugin against the staging registry using the build token listed below.

build token for kagaf-hahof: htk14_9d3d4d26d7d8de

Subject: Formula sandboxing lands in Tallowbird 4.2

Hey plugin folks,

Starting with this release, user-supplied formulas run inside the new Glassbox sandbox. No more direct filesystem or network calls from formula code — if your plugin relied on those, switch to the declared capability hooks documented in the porting guide. Most plugins need zero changes; the rest should take an afternoon. Please test against the beta channel this week and flag anything weird. The beta build token is right below for reference.

session token of fahap-hawip = htk31_7852f2b3276dba2738f98fa97f92237

**Ticket QMX-889: Compaction vault sealed, review needed**

Log compaction on the Ferrowline queue halted at segment 4471. Root cause: the compactor's credential vault sealed itself after three failed token renewals. Compacted segments are intact; no data loss. Fix is merged and awaiting your review. To reproduce locally and verify the unseal path, you need vault access. Per procedure, documenting it here for reviewer use. The recovery passphrase follows.

unlock words, fafop-hawep: briwyn-oliix-sorox

TURN-208: Gatevale turnstile counters at the Merrow Field pilot double-count when a rotation reverses mid-cycle. Attendance totals drift roughly 2% high per event. The debounce window fix is implemented, reviewed by Ilsa, and soak-tested across two simulated match days without drift. Ready for your cut; the candidate build is identified below.

trace token, tagag-tafog: htk6_5ed18c